Sex Trafficking Demand Reduction Act

Last updated: 5/26/2026 · Introduced: 5/26/2026

Author: Ann Wagner (R-MO)

TL;DR (AI)

  • This bill amends the Trafficking Victims Protection Act of 2000 to modify the criteria used to evaluate foreign countries' efforts to reduce demand for commercial sex acts.
  • The changes to these evaluation criteria apply to determinations made on or after the bill's enactment.
  • The bill's purpose is to reduce demand for sex trafficking by amending existing law.
